The Anatomy of Smart Contract Vulnerabilities

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. While they eliminate the need for intermediaries, they are not immune to errors. Common vulnerabilities include:

Integer Overflow and Underflow: Arithmetic operations can lead to unexpected results when integers exceed their maximum or minimum values. Hackers exploit these flaws to manipulate contract states and execute unauthorized transactions.

Reentrancy Attacks: This attack involves calling a function repeatedly before the initial function execution completes, allowing attackers to manipulate the contract's state and drain funds.

Timestamp Manipulation: Contracts relying on block timestamps can be vulnerable to manipulation, allowing attackers to exploit timing discrepancies for malicious gains.

Access Control Flaws: Poorly implemented access control mechanisms can allow unauthorized users to execute sensitive functions, leading to potential data breaches and asset theft.

Real-World Examples

To truly grasp the implications of these vulnerabilities, let’s examine some notorious incidents:

The DAO Hack (2016): The Decentralized Autonomous Organization (DAO) was an innovative smart contract on the Ethereum network that raised funds for startups. An exploit in its code allowed a hacker to drain approximately $50 million worth of Ether. This breach underscored the importance of rigorous auditing and security measures in smart contract development.

The Importance of Thorough Audits

Post-mortem analyses following these breaches reveal the critical need for comprehensive audits. A thorough audit should include:

Static Analysis: Automated tools to detect common vulnerabilities like overflows, reentrancy, and access control flaws.

Dynamic Analysis: Simulation of contract execution to identify runtime errors and unexpected behaviors.

Formal Verification: Mathematical proofs to ensure that the contract behaves as intended under all conditions.

Best Practices for Smart Contract Security

To fortify smart contracts against potential attacks, consider these best practices:

Use Established Libraries: Leverage well-audited libraries like OpenZeppelin, which provide secure implementations of common smart contract patterns.

Conduct Regular Audits: Engage third-party security firms to conduct regular audits and vulnerability assessments.

Implement Proper Access Control: Use access control mechanisms like the onlyOwner modifier to restrict sensitive functions to authorized users.

Test Extensively: Use unit tests, integration tests, and fuzz testing to identify and rectify vulnerabilities before deployment.

Stay Updated: Keep abreast of the latest security trends and updates in the blockchain ecosystem to preemptively address emerging threats.

Advanced Detection and Mitigation Strategies

While basic security measures provide a foundation, advanced strategies offer deeper protection against sophisticated attacks. These include:

Smart Contract Debugging: Debugging tools like Echidna and MythX enable detailed analysis of smart contract code, identifying potential vulnerabilities and anomalies.

Fuzz Testing: Fuzz testing involves inputting random data to uncover unexpected behaviors and vulnerabilities. This technique helps identify edge cases that might not surface during standard testing.

Gas Limit Analysis: By analyzing gas usage patterns, developers can identify functions that may be vulnerable to gas limit attacks. This analysis helps optimize contract efficiency and security.

Contract Interaction Monitoring: Monitoring interactions between contracts can reveal patterns indicative of reentrancy or other attacks. Tools like Etherscan provide real-time insights into contract activities.

Future Trends in Blockchain Security

The future of blockchain security is poised for significant advancements. Here are some trends to watch:

Zero-Knowledge Proofs (ZKPs): ZKPs allow one party to prove to another that a certain statement is true without revealing any additional information. This technology can enhance privacy and security in smart contracts.

Sidechains and Sharding: Sidechains and sharding aim to improve scalability and security by distributing the network’s load. These technologies can reduce the risk of 51% attacks and enhance overall network security.

Decentralized Identity (DID): DID technologies enable individuals to control their digital identity, reducing the risk of identity theft and enhancing security in smart contracts.
